UCLA Health is seeking a board-certified/board-eligible Radiation Oncologist to join our team in a flexible staff physician role supporting UCLA Health Radiation Oncology locations across Southern California. This position offers the opportunity to provide high-quality, patient-centered cancer care while supporting practices throughout our growing regional network, with clinical coverage of up to eight days per month. The role is ideal for a physician who values flexibility, enjoys practicing across diverse clinical environments, and is interested in bringing UCLA Health's expertise and standard of care to patients throughout Southern California.
The UCLA Department of Radiation Oncology is committed to advancing cancer care through innovative treatment approaches, advanced technologies, and close multidisciplinary collaboration. As a staff physician, you will work alongside experienced oncology professionals to provide individualized radiation therapy and coordinated cancer care across UCLA Health's regional practices.
Some Of Your Clinical Responsibilities Include
- Provide Radiation Oncology coverage at UCLA Health locations throughout Southern California, based on clinical and operational needs
- Evaluate and manage patients who may benefit from radiation therapy as part of their comprehensive cancer treatment
- Provide radiation oncology consultation, treatment planning, on-treatment management, and follow-up care
- Develop individualized radiation treatment plans based on each patient’s diagnosis and clinical needs
- Collaborate with medical oncology, surgical oncology, radiology, pathology, medical physics, and other members of the multidisciplinary care team
- Utilize advanced radiation therapy technologies and techniques to deliver precise, patient-centered treatment
- Maintain timely and accurate clinical documentation within the electronic medical record
- Support quality, safety, and continuous improvement initiatives within Radiation Oncology
- Provide clinical coverage for up to eight days per month
Required Qualifications
- MD or DO
- Board Certified or Board Eligible in Radiation Oncology
- Completion of an ACGME-accredited Radiation Oncology residency
- Active California medical license or eligibility for California licensure
- Ability and willingness to provide clinical coverage across UCLA Health Radiation Oncology locations throughout Southern California
- Commitment to delivering high-quality, patient-centered cancer care
- Strong communication and collaboration skills within a multidisciplinary clinical environment
